Ingredients
2 large potatoes, boiled and mashed
8 regular bread slices
A bunch of coriander leaves, finely chopped
Green chillies, finely chopped
Red chilli powder, to taste
Salt, to taste
1/4 teaspoon garam masala powder

Method
- In a mixing bowl, combine mashed potatoes, salt, red chilli powder, garam masala, chopped green chillies, and coriander leaves. Mix well to form a flavourful filling.
- Take water in a small bowl. Quickly dip a bread slice in water for a few seconds.
- Gently squeeze out excess water by pressing the bread between your palms.
- Place about 1 tablespoon of the potato mixture in the centre of the damp bread.
- Carefully roll and seal the bread, ensuring the filling is completely enclosed.
- Repeat the process with the remaining bread slices and filling.
- Heat Freedom Refined Rice Bran Oil in a kadai over medium flame.
- Deep fry the bread rolls until golden brown and crisp on all sides.
- Remove and drain on absorbent paper.
